What is the Gift Aid Declaration Form?
The Gift Aid Declaration Form is essential for donors in the United Kingdom. This form enables UK charities to reclaim tax on donations made by individuals. By completing the Gift Aid Declaration Form, donors can ensure that charities, such as Save the Elephants, receive additional funding by reclaiming the basic rate of income tax paid on their donations.
This process supports the mission of registered charities while providing a tax relief donation form that benefits both parties involved.
Why Should You Use the Gift Aid Declaration Form?
Completing the Gift Aid Declaration Form offers significant advantages for both donors and charities. Donors can enjoy tax relief benefits, allowing them to reclaim the basic rate of income tax on their contributions. This means that for every £1 donated, the charity can claim an additional 25p from the government.
For charities, utilizing the charity gift aid form can result in increased funding. This reclaimed tax can be a vital source of income, enhancing the financial sustainability of charitable organizations.

Who Needs the Gift Aid Declaration Form?
The Gift Aid Declaration Form is intended for any individual who qualifies as a donor under UK tax law. To be eligible to reclaim Gift Aid, donors must be paying enough income tax or capital gains tax to cover the tax reclaimed by charities on their donations.
Charities are responsible for collecting and submitting these forms to ensure that they can benefit from reclaimed taxes, making it essential for both donors and charities to understand their obligations.

Who can complete the Gift Aid Declaration Form?
Any individual who makes donations to a registered charity in the UK is eligible to fill out the Gift Aid Declaration Form to enable tax reclaim processes.
Are there any deadlines for submitting this form?
Generally, there is no strict deadline, but completing it as quickly as possible following your donation is advisable to allow the charity to reclaim tax efficiently.
How should I submit the Gift Aid Declaration Form after completing it?
After completing the Gift Aid Declaration Form, return it to the charity directly via mail or email as instructed. Ensure that your signature is included.
What supporting documents are required for the Gift Aid Declaration Form?
Usually, no supporting documents are needed when submitting the Gift Aid Declaration Form itself. However, it’s important to keep a record of your donation for personal tax records.
What mistakes should I av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include not signing the form, missing out on filling in all required fields, and failing to provide accurate personal information, which may hinder the charity's ability to reclaim tax.
How long does it take for charities to process the Gift Aid Declaration?
Processing times can vary by charity, but typically, they can reclaim tax within a few weeks once they have received your completed form.
Can I revoke my Gift Aid Declaration later?
Yes, you can revoke your Gift Aid Declaration at any time. It’s important to communicate this to the charity to prevent any future tax claim issues.
